Kalel is a bit of an enigma in the YouTube world. She’s known for frequently deleting her content before re-branding and starting up a whole new channel. Her past channels have covered beauty tips, cosplay costumes, lifestyle/advice videos, DIY fashion & craft. Back in 2016, she re-branded again and now her channel is simply called Kalel. She doesn’t post very consistently, but when she has in the past she would talk a lot about her vegan diet and give some lifestyle advice. She’s also described as an animal activist and has two beautiful cats at home. One interesting bit of new information is that about one year ago, she stopped following a vegan diet and began introducing animal products into her diet. In this video we explore: detox teas, transitioning from a vegan diet to incorporating animal products & nutrient deficiencies. What I Like About Kalel’s Diet: Her Honesty & Openness Her meals are simple and balanced What I Think Kalel Can Improve On: Ditch the tea propaganda & misinformation Get in enough calories Her language around weight and beauty I like that Kalel is brutally honest with her viewers, and seems to really appreciate the many followers in her life. At the same time, with that many followers, I think she’s got a long way to go when it comes to being a positive role model for the many young girls that follow her. In her next videos, I hope she thinks twice about some of the language she uses when discussing her weight and does a background check on a few nutrition claims before sharing them with her audience.
